Virtual Health Solution - VHS is looking for an experienced salaried GP for a part-time role at their Barking practice. This position requires 5–6 hours per week, combining face-to-face and remote consultations. GPs will have 10-minute appointment slots to ensure a high level of patient care.
We offer competitive hourly rates, a pension scheme, and the support of a modern practice team in a diverse community. Immediate start available for candidates already familiar with NHS systems, or onboarding can be arranged.
